What is Ground Balance?

If you’ve ever used a metal detector, you may have come across the term “ground balance.” But what exactly is ground balance and why is it important? Ground balance is a feature on a metal detector that allows it to adjust to different soil conditions and mineralization levels. It essentially balances out the signals from the ground so that they don’t interfere with the detection of metal objects.

Metal detectors emit a magnetic field that interacts with the minerals and conductivity of the soil. Some soil contains high levels of minerals that can create false signals, making it difficult for the detector to accurately detect metal objects. By adjusting the ground balance, you can effectively filter out these false signals and improve the detector’s performance.

FAQs

What is ground balance on a metal detector?
Ground balance on a metal detector refers to the adjustment of the detector to account for the mineralization in the ground. It helps eliminate false signals caused by mineralized soil, allowing the detector to accurately identify metal targets.

How does ground balance affect metal detecting?
Ground balance is crucial in metal detecting as it allows the detector to distinguish between mineralization in the ground and actual metal targets. By properly adjusting the ground balance, a detector can operate more effectively and accurately detect valuable targets.

What happens if the ground balance is not set correctly on a metal detector?
If the ground balance is not set correctly, a metal detector may produce false signals or struggle to detect targets in highly mineralized soil. This can result in missed targets or wasted time digging up false signals.

Are all metal detectors equipped with ground balance adjustment?
Not all metal detectors have ground balance adjustment. Some entry-level detectors may have fixed ground balance settings, while more advanced models often feature manual or automatic ground balancing capabilities.

Can ground balance be adjusted automatically on a metal detector?
Yes, many modern metal detectors offer automatic ground balancing. These detectors use built-in algorithms to continuously adjust the ground balance settings as the user moves the detector, making it easier for beginners to set up and use.

Can ground balance affect the depth of detection?
Yes, ground balance can indeed affect the depth of detection. By properly adjusting the ground balance, a metal detector can optimize its performance and maximize the depth at which it can detect metal targets.
